The Haunted Hotel: A Mystery of Modern Venice is a novel by Wilkie Collins. It was originally published in 1879 and since then there have been other editions published by Borgo Press in 2002 in London, England. Set in Venice, Italy, The Haunted Hotel tells the mysterious tale of a haunting in the Palace Hotel after the death of Lord Montberry.The late Lord Montberry supposedly haunts the hotel where Agnes Lockwood, Henry Westwick, Stephen Westwick, Countess Narona, Emily Ferrari, and Francis Westwick have come to dig into the mysterious death. Terror fills the hotel as dark and strange occurrences begin to take fold.
